Sergio Gor Sworn In as U.S. Ambassador to India in Oval Office Ceremony

The appointment underscores the administration’s focus on deepening ties with India.

Overview

  • Vice President J.D. Vance administered the oath on November 10, with Gor also designated special envoy to South and Central Asia.
  • President Trump praised Gor and said he is trusting him to help strengthen the U.S. strategic partnership with India.
  • Turning Point CEO Erika Kirk delivered an emotional tribute, invoking her late husband Charlie Kirk and offering support for Gor’s tenure.
  • Senior officials attended, including Secretary of State Marco Rubio,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ent, Attorney General Pam Bondi, and U.S. Attorney Jeanine Pirro, with several senators present.
  • Gor’s background includes work with Trump since 2020, roles at MAGA Inc. and Right for America, co-founding Winning Team Publishing, and an October visit to meet Prime Minister Narendra Modi, S. Jaishankar, and Ajit Doval.
